What is Talkdesk?

Talkdesk is a cloud-based contact center software provider that helps businesses improve their customer service operations. The platform offers tools for inbound and outbound calls, customer support automation, AI-powered analytics, and integrations with CRM and business applications. Companies use Talkdesk to enhance the customer experience, streamline communication, and increase agent productivity across multiple channels. The software is scalable and suitable for businesses of all sizes.

What are some common challenges faced by Talkdesk implementation specialists when onboarding new clients?

Talkdesk implementation specialists often encounter challenges such as integrating the platform with clients' existing systems, customizing workflows to fit specific business needs, and ensuring all stakeholders are adequately trained. Balancing tight project timelines with the need for thorough testing and user adoption can also be demanding. Effective communication and proactive problem-solving are essential, as specialists frequently collaborate with IT teams, end-users, and customer success managers to deliver a smooth onboarding experience.

Job description

Location:

Onsite in Jacksonville, FL

Schedule:

Monday - Friday, 8am – 5pm

Salary range:

$15.74 - $21.63, depending upon experience

What work will you perform?

The Customer Service Representative I (“CSRI”) is primarily responsible for providing excellent customer service to anyone calling Landstar.  This includes Landstar’s customers, agents, BCOs, and other third-party carriers. As the first line of contact, Landstar’s CSR’s respond to inquiries, provide information, and provide basic support with the intention of resolving routine issues and requests in a single call.  Your ability to actively listen, manage high call volumes, create and save detailed interaction notes and leave the customer with a positive impression are paramount to being successful in this role.

Essential Responsibilities:

  • Consistently manage high volumes of inbound and outbound customer interactions via phone calls, emails, chat and SMS across multiple lines of business/product lines.
  • Respond to inquiries seeking general information on Landstar’s services and processes.
  • Identify and assess customer needs. Resolve routine questions, issues, and complaints by providing information and mostly standard solutions to customers, agents, BCOs and third-party carriers. Act in the capacity of a liaison between these parties during the resolution process.
  • Able to resolve most calls without escalation while avoiding unnecessary transfers.
  • Utilize Talkdesk and other systems to handle and accurately document interactions.  Documentation must clearly summarize all issues and the resolution so that all parties are able to follow up with customers with complete knowledge of the situation.   
  • Adhere to assigned work schedule and flex as needed.   

Required Minimum Experience and Education:

  • High school diploma or equivalent.
  • 6 months of related customer service or call center experience

Preferred Experience and Education:

  • Prior experience in transportation services or logistics is preferred

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ities:

  • Communication Skills: The ability to communicate clearly and concisely both orally and in writing. Must also possess strong listening skills including the ability to discern/ evaluate caller’s issues and respond appropriately.
  • Problem Solving: Must be able to understand and resolve problems quickly and accurately.
  • Time Management: Must be able to handle calls efficiently, multi-task, and prioritize.
  • Computer Systems/ Technology Skills: Ability to use multiple web-based tools to support customer needs simultaneously and to accurately document all interactions. 
  • Mutli-tasking:  Must be able to perform more than one task or media (e.g., phone, email, chat, etc.) simultaneously.  This skill often entails using multiple media to obtain information and finalize resolution direction.
  • Ability and willingness to continuously train and become conversant in multiple lines of business
